Transaction 77f51f317527e2e16752f258dcd67c4615e128629ffb0468b6e5d8695800e495
1 Input
2 Outputs
- 77f51f317527e2e16752f258dcd67c4615e128629ffb0468b6e5d8695800e495:0
- 77f51f317527e2e16752f258dcd67c4615e128629ffb0468b6e5d8695800e495:1
value 5026
address 13xgJLG4JVPETW4UmGMbBtW6LpR7ipKbaV
value 69630000
address 14gyhcWPCGa3HkoDdSYaP1PwcbEXTjwPmT